YG Entertainment to Debut Youngest Girl Group Ever

YG Entertainment, the Korean talent agency that introduced BLACKPINK to the world is reportedly gearing to launch a new all-female pop group. 

“It is true that YG is preparing to launch a new girl group,” a source reported on Hypebae.

YG Entertainment has been vague about the nitty gritty details as of now, but it should be noted that this is the first time the entertainment industry giant is launching a girl group in five years.

Though it’s common practice in the K-Pop industry to start training talents at a young age, this group of ‘elite teens’ will comprise the youngest members to date. To give you an idea, the average age of YG’s first hit girl group, 2NE1, during their debut was 20. Meanwhile, BLACKPINK’s Jennie, Rosé, Jisoo, and Lisa were all within the ages of 19 and 21 when they were introduced to the industry as per Philstarlife.com.

Well, this elite girl group has big shoes to fill as YG Entertainment’s other girl groups shot to global fame with their cultural impact, luxury brand deals, and record-breaking hits. Well, YG Entertainment does have a good track record as it handles big names in Korean pop culture such as Sechs Kies, Big Bang, Akdong Musician, Winner, iKon, Blackpink, and Treasure as well as actors and actresses including Kang Dong-won, Choi Ji-woo, Cha Seung-won, Lee Sung-kyung, Jin Kyung, Yoo In-na, and Son Na-eun.

When will the new girl group be revealed? It’s said they’re slated to make their debut within the year.
